Independent Cultural Values
Cultural norms and values that emphasize self-reliance, individual achievement, and personal autonomy.
Traditional Classrooms
Educational settings characterized by in-person, teacher-led instruction in a classroom environment, often featuring a structured curriculum.
Cultural Norms
Shared beliefs or behaviors considered acceptable and standard within a specific society or group.
Directive Child-Rearing Methods
Parenting techniques that involve explicit instructions and expectations from parents to children, often emphasizing obedience and discipline.
